While the Hill is honed in on tax reform, there is also that pesky little problem of keeping the government funded. The problem is, time's a ticking. Congress has until December 8 to pass some sort of spending bill or a short-term fix.

The Big Four in Congress ... Speaker Paul Ryan, [Majority Leader] Mitch McConnell in the Senate, the Democratic leaders Nancy Pelosi and Chuck Schumer, are quietly sort of negotiating a year-end spending deal," Bade reports.

"They are running out of time and they're terribly far apart right now, with Democrats still pushing for a DACA fix and a solution for Dreamers. Republicans are worried that if they increase spending without offsets and do a DACA fix that the far right is going to totally go off the rails."
